I am new here so here's some introduction. I live in the Netherlands and have owned the SVX since 2018. I purchased it in Spain, but the car is originally from Switzerland. The SVX is our second car (the main one being a Subaru XV (aka Crosstrek in the US) with a paltry 1.6 liter engine (which suffices in our flat crowded country), so the SVX is for pleasure driving in nice weather conditions only. Last year the car had been in the repair shop almost all year because of a radiator leakage and then a transmission rebuild. This year the plan was to compensate last year's loss (of not being able to drive it) by driving it more often, but now, due to the Coronavirus, everyone is advised to stay indoors so it seemed a bit antisocial to do pleasure driving now ... The plan is to keep the SVX as long as possible and to keep it properly maintained too. Really Huck?
The code on the plate is 947. Maybe you know it under a different name? Sometimes they do that. It was used on early Liberty/Legacy as well. Changed later on to 309 Carmine Mica. |
